WATERFORD, Wis. (CBS 58) -- One of the largest garage sales of its kind in our area is having its last hoorah starting Thursday. Hippie Tom has decided to hang it up after this weekend’s run. For years, people have come from all over, both in the spring and fall, to get their hands on whatever cool findings they can at Serendipity Farm in Waterford. But Hippie Tom says even though this is the end of his semi annual events, this collector once featured on “American Pickers” says he isn’t totally going away. He tells me he'll try to do "pop up" sales from time to time. He wants everyone to stay in touch with him through his Facebook page.
Hippie Tom’s last five-day sale runs Thursday through Columbus Day on Monday. It goes from 9 until 4 each day. The farm is at 64-04 Marsh Road in Waterford.
